About the role

Navigating Berlin's Digital Transformation

Berlin has evolved into a global hub for both hyper-growth startups and established enterprise offices undergoing digital shifts. In this fast-paced ecosystem, a skilled coordinator is essential to bridge the gap between business strategy and technical execution. These professionals guide local development teams, align international stakeholders, and ensure that software releases, infrastructure upgrades, and system integrations stay on track.

Key Responsibilities and Deliverables

Experienced coordinators bring structure to complex technological undertakings by producing clear, actionable outputs throughout the project lifecycle.

  • Defining project scope, milestones, resource allocation, and risk mitigation strategies.
  • Facilitating agile ceremonies, including sprint planning, daily standups, and retrospectives.
  • Managing budgets, vendor relationships, and third-party integrations.
  • Delivering status reports and alignment documentation for C-level executives.
  • Ensuring compliance with European data security laws such as GDPR.

Essential Methodologies and Tools

Successful professionals adapt their approach to your organizational culture, whether that requires pure Agile frameworks, traditional Waterfall planning, or hybrid methodologies. They are highly proficient with modern collaboration tools like Jira, Confluence, and Asana, and possess a strong understanding of technical concepts, from cloud architectures to DevOps pipelines. This technical literacy allows them to communicate effectively with developers, QA engineers, and system architects alike.

Frequently Asked Questions

Want to learn more? Find helpful information about FRATCH

An IT Project Manager coordinates complex technology projects, aligning cross-functional teams to deliver software, cloud migrations, or infrastructure upgrades. In the local market, they often manage international, bilingual teams and ensure that digital initiatives align with business goals while staying on schedule and budget.

While a Scrum Master focuses on team dynamics and removing development obstacles within the Scrum framework, an Agile Project Manager holds a broader strategic view. They manage budgets, handle stakeholder communication, assess risks, and ensure the overall project aligns with the company’s high-level business objectives.

A competent IT Project Lead is highly skilled in tracking and collaboration tools such as Jira, Confluence, and MS Project. They should also understand modern development workflows, CI/CD pipelines, and cloud environments like AWS or Azure to communicate effectively with technical teams.

Hiring a freelance IT Project Manager allows you to bring in specialized expertise for specific, time-limited initiatives like cloud migrations or system rollouts. Freelancers offer immediate availability, objective industry perspectives, and the flexibility to scale down once the project reaches successful completion.

Many companies adopt a hybrid model, combining remote planning with selective onsite workshops at the Berlin office for key milestones. A freelance Technical Project Manager can easily adapt to your preferred setup, utilizing digital collaboration tools to keep remote and distributed teams fully aligned.

You can assess a freelance IT PM by reviewing their past successful deliveries, certifications like PMP or Prince2, and their adaptability to different tech stacks. A strong candidate demonstrates clear communication, proactive risk management, and the ability to quickly integrate into existing team structures.

Yes, an experienced IT Project Manager is highly valuable during complex legacy migrations, as they specialize in risk mitigation and phased transitions. They map out dependencies, coordinate downtime windows, and ensure minimal disruption to daily business operations during critical infrastructure shifts.

Because Berlin is a global tech hub, almost every IT Project Manager in Berlin is expected to speak fluent English, which is the primary language of many development teams. Depending on your stakeholders and local regulatory requirements, proficiency in German can also be a significant advantage for coordinating with local entities.
